预览加载中,请您耐心等待几秒...
1/2
2/2

在线预览结束,喜欢就下载吧,查找使用更方便

如果您无法下载资料,请参考说明:

1、部分资料下载需要金币,请确保您的账户上有足够的金币

2、已购买过的文档,再次下载不重复扣费

3、资料包下载后请先用软件解压,在使用对应软件打开

基于稀疏分解的图像压缩编码算法研究 随着科技的不断发展,数字图像在我们的生活中扮演着越来越重要的角色。为了在传输和储存时减小文件大小,图像压缩变得越来越必要。而基于稀疏分解的图像压缩编码算法则是一种目前较为常见和有效的方法之一。本文将对该算法进行探讨和分析。 一、稀疏分解的概念 稀疏分解是指将某个信号或数据表示成若干基向量的线性组合的过程,其中只有部分基向量系数不为零。也就是说,信号或数据在某些基向量上有较强的表示能力,而在其他基向量上却几乎没有表示能力。这种表示方法可以减小数据存储和传输时的大小,同时也方便了数据处理和分析。 二、基于稀疏分解的图像压缩编码算法 基于稀疏分解的图像压缩编码算法可以分为两个部分:压缩和解压缩。 1.压缩 在压缩阶段,首先将原始图像转换成一组基向量表示。这里使用离散余弦变换(DCT)或小波变换(WaveletTransform)等变换算法来进行转换。接下来,利用L1范数或L0范数等算法对系数矩阵进行压缩。这些算法都是基于稀疏分解理论而设计的,在保证压缩比率的情况下,尽可能地减少失真和信息丢失。 2.解压缩 在解压缩阶段,压缩后的系数矩阵通过逆变换算法转换回原始图像。由于压缩阶段只保留了部分系数,所以解压缩后的图像会有失真,但是这种失真是可控的,可以根据压缩比例进行调整和控制。 三、优点与缺点 基于稀疏分解的图像压缩编码算法具有以下优点: 1.能够在保证较高压缩率的情况下尽可能减少失真和信息丢失。 2.稀疏分解可以提取信号或数据的重要信息,便于数据处理和分析。 3.压缩后的文件大小小,便于存储和传输。 但是,该算法也存在一些缺点: 1.稀疏分解需要进行转换和压缩操作,计算复杂度较高,需要较长的处理时间。 2.在压缩与解压缩的过程中,需要进行逆变换,会带来失真和信息丢失。 四、应用前景 基于稀疏分解的图像压缩编码算法在图像压缩、传输和存储等领域具有广泛的应用前景。该算法能够减小数据大小、提高传输速率,同时也能够保证数据的准确性和完整性。此外,稀疏分解理论还可以应用于音频、视频等其他形式的数字数据压缩和处理中。 总的来说,基于稀疏分解的图像压缩编码算法是一种高效且可靠的压缩方法。但是,在实际应用中,需要根据具体情况对压缩比例、算法选择等进行调整和优化,以满足不同的需求和场景。